U.S. Capitol Police wisely issued an advisory to its 1,800 officers warning that Nation of Islam's participation in the march would increase the likelihood of violence at the event. The document stated with complete accuracy that the cultish group's incendiary racist leader, Louis Farrakhan, “has been accused of inciting violence against both Caucasians and police officers.”
The memo acknowledged that the original Million Man March years ago, which the National Park Service at the time estimated had merely 400,000 in attendance, was not violent, but prudently cautioned that “given today’s negative racial climate and the rise of the Black Lives Matter movement,” the second march this weekend “may not be as peaceful.”
But in the nation's capital, common sense and forthrightness are career-killers. Political correctness soon forced that police department, which patrols the United States Capitol complex in Washington, D.C., and neighborhoods around it, to tuck tail and walk back the warning.
Capitol Police Chief Kim Dine said the surprisingly controversial warning “does not reflect the viewpoint or values of the United States Capitol Police, nor was it intended to provide instruction or guidance to our employees.”
